Basic cable calculation
Checking Iz 
From BS7671

Method is used in items 5.1 and 5.2    Ib or In / Correction factors
 
It should be noted that the value of (It) appearing against the chosen cross-sectional area is not (Iz).
It is not necessary to know Iz where the size of conductor is chosen by this method.

But it is possible to get incorrect coordination with cable calculations that seem acceptable?


Ib   28A
In 32A
L 40m
Ca 0.94
Cg 0.7
 
Cable T&E
Clipped direct
 
Calculation
 
It ≥ Ib ÷ correction factors so:    It ≥  28 ÷ 0.94 x 0.7 =  42.5A
 
Table 4D2A Method C  6mm2  cable - 46A   It = 46
 
Volt drop 8.17V
 
So 6mm cabe looks OK
 
But if I do check Iz
 
Iz = It x Correction factors     46 x 0.94 x 0.7 = 30.26A
 
Ib ≤  In ≤ Iz      28 ≤ 32 ≤ 30.26
